Comprehending French Door Windows

French door windows, often merely called French doors, consist of 2 hinged panels that open external or inward from the center. Unlike standard doors, these features feature substantial glass pane plans, typically divided by muntins or grid patterns that create their unique segmented appearance. The glass panels typically extend throughout most of the door's surface, enabling optimal natural light to filter into the interior while supplying clear views of the surrounding landscape.

The origins of French doors trace back to seventeenth-century France, where they progressed from earlier Italian designs. French nobility embraced these elegant入口ways as a way to link official reception spaces with terrace gardens, producing an advanced interplay in between interior luxury and outside natural beauty. This historical pedigree provides French door windows a fundamental elegance that few other architectural aspects can match.

Modern French door windows have actually progressed significantly while keeping their necessary character. Today's versions include advanced glazing innovations, improved weather sealing, and diverse frame materials that enhance energy effectiveness without compromising aesthetic appeal. Homeowners can now enjoy the classic elegance of French doors while benefiting from modern efficiency requirements that keep homes comfy year-round.

Design Options and Material Choices

French door windows been available in a remarkable range of styles and materials, allowing homeowners to choose choices that completely complement their architectural preferences and efficiency requirements.

Wood French doors remain the essential option for conventional and colonial-style homes. Manufacturers craft these doors from numerous hardwoods, consisting of oak, mahogany, and fir, each offering distinct grain patterns and color tones. Wood frames can be painted or stained to match interior trim and architectural aspects, supplying extraordinary design versatility. However, wood requires regular upkeep including periodic refinishing to safeguard against wetness, insects, and UV damage.

Fiberglass French doors have actually gained considerable popularity in recent years due to their outstanding toughness and very little maintenance requirements. These doors resist denting, scratching, and weather damage far much better than wood, and they will not rot, warp, or rust. Modern fiberglass doors include convincing wood grain textures that satisfy visual choices while providing exceptional performance. Their insulating properties normally go beyond those of wood and vinyl alternatives.

Vinyl French doors use the most cost-effective entry point into French door ownership. These frames need virtually no maintenance beyond occasional cleaning and resist fading, peeling, and corrosion efficiently. While color choices have expanded substantially, vinyl frames usually can not match the abundant look of wood or the structural strength of fiberglass or aluminum.

Aluminum French doors fit contemporary architectural designs especially well. Their slim profiles maximize glass surface location, developing a streamlined, modern look that attract design-conscious house owners. Aluminum's remarkable strength enables larger door panels and broader openings than other products usually support. Thermal break innovation has enhanced aluminum's energy performance substantially, though these doors typically cost more than vinyl or fiberglass options.

Energy Efficiency Considerations

Energy effectiveness deserves mindful attention when picking French door windows, as the comprehensive glass surface area can considerably impact heating & cooling costs. Fortunately, contemporary manufacturing techniques have produced French doors that carry out exceptionally well in terms of thermal performance.

Double glazing, including two panes of glass separated by a vacuum or gas-filled area, represents the requirement for energy-efficient French doors. This building and construction drastically lowers heat transfer compared to single-pane designs, keeping interiors comfortable no matter exterior temperature levels. Low-emissivity (low-E) finishes used to glass surface areas further boost performance by reflecting infrared heat while enabling noticeable light to go through.

Gas fills, normally utilizing argon or krypton between glass panes, improve insulating homes by minimizing conduction through the glazing assembly. Though undetectable to residents, these gas fills contribute meaningfully to overall energy performance. Frame materials and building and construction quality likewise affect thermal performance, as spaces, bad seals, and thermal bridges can weaken even high-quality glazing.

Correct setup proves equally crucial as product quality. Even the most energy-efficient French doors will underperform if installed improperly. Professional setup makes sure appropriate flashing, sealing, and positioning that takes full advantage of performance and avoids air leakage around the frame. House owners must verify that installers follow producer requirements and appropriate building codes.

Upkeep Requirements and Care Tips

Preserving French door windows properly ensures their charm and efficiency sustain for decades. Different frame products need somewhat various upkeep approaches, though some basic practices apply generally.

Wood French doors require the most attentive maintenance routine. Owners must check finish condition every year, searching for locations where paint or stain has used thin or peeled. Repainting or restaining immediately prevents wetness from permeating the wood, which might cause swelling, warping, or rot. Cleaning up wood frames with moderate soap and water eliminates built up dirt without damaging finishes. Using fresh sealant to weatherstripping as required keeps energy efficiency and prevents drafts.

Fiberglass and vinyl French doors require far less extensive maintenance. Routine cleansing with soap and water keeps frames looking fresh, while routine assessment of weatherstripping and hardware guarantees continued proper operation. These products never require refinishing, though vinyl might yellow somewhat over decades of sun direct exposure in some environments.

All French door owners need to lubricate hinges and hardware yearly to guarantee smooth operation. Stiff or squeaky hinges often respond well to silicone-based lubricants that will not attract dust or gum up mechanisms. Checking and changing door alignment seasonally helps prevent premature wear on hinges, locks, and weatherstripping.

Do French door windows provide adequate security?

Modern French door windows offer excellent security when geared up with proper hardware and set up properly. Multi-point locking systems that protect doors at multiple points along the frame provide exceptional defense compared to standard single-point locks. Tempered or laminated glass options resist breakage, and quality hardware with strong hinges and safe mounting avoids forced entry efforts. While any door with glass presents some theoretical vulnerability, well-constructed French doors with современная фурнитура compare positively with other door key ins security assessments.

Are French doors appropriate for all climate conditions?

French door windows perform well in diverse environment conditions when effectively chosen and installed. Cold environment installations benefit from doors with outstanding insulating residential or commercial properties, consisting of triple glazing and thermal break frame building and construction. Hot environment applications require low-E finishes that block infrared heat while permitting light transmission. Coastal installations demand corrosion-resistant hardware and finishes that stand up to salt air direct exposure. Manufacturers style particular line of product for local conditions, and talking to local suppliers assists ensure appropriate selections.
